Fraktion#
Fraktion (Parliamentary Party), association of like-minded members of parliament (in the Nationalrat, Landtag in the provinces or municipal councils) usually belonging to one political party. Party discipline means that the members of a parliamentary party must vote on a measure as previously agreed upon; although it contradicts the concept of the free mandate, this is common practice in Austria. In the Nationalrat, the Fraktion (Parliamentary Party) is called "Klub" and is headed by the "Klubobmann", or the Chairman.
